About this listen
From Southern California, Kali Boykin describes how her mom impacted her and her sister’s love for the outdoors. How she found OBA (Outward Bound Adventures) through Doli (Diversified Outdoor Leader Institute) and is inspired to educate and provide outdoor excursions for black and brown youths. We also talk about why she chose to pursue a Masters in Family & Marriage counseling and in a rare opportunity, Kali flips the interview and asks about my travel dreams and we discuss the conflict between home and exploring the nomad spirit inside of us.
